Concrete floor demolition involves the careful removal of existing concrete surfaces, whether in residential, commercial, or industrial properties. This process typically includes breaking up and removing old or damaged concrete slabs, foundations, or walkways to prepare a space for new construction or renovation.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the demolition is efficient, safe, and minimizes disruption to the surrounding areas. This service is essential when old concrete has become cracked, stained, or structurally compromised, making it unsuitable for continued use or aesthetic purposes.
Many property owners turn to concrete floor demolition to address a variety of problems. Cracks, uneven surfaces, or deterioration over time can compromise safety and functionality. In some cases, concrete may be stained or damaged beyond simple repair, requiring complete removal before installing new flooring or structural elements. Demolition also helps create a clean slate for remodeling projects, such as transforming a garage or basement into a livable space. By removing outdated or unsafe concrete, property owners can ensure their spaces are both functional and safe.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Floor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Pensacola,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ete floor demolition projects in Pensacola range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s, such as removing small sections or patching, fall within this range.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this bracket.
Medium-Scale Demolition - For larger areas or more involved demolition work, local contractors often charge between $700 and $2,500. These projects are common for residential or commercial spaces needing partial removal or preparation for new flooring.
Full Floor Removal - Complete demolition of an entire concrete floor can cost from $3,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on size and complexity.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into this higher cost range.
Heavy-Duty or Specialty Work - Projects requiring specialized techniques or dealing with reinforced concrete may range from $5,000 to $10,000+. Such jobs are less frequent and typically involve complex or commercial demolition tasks.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in concrete floor demolition? Concrete floor demolition typically includes breaking up and removing existing concrete surfaces, often using specialized equipment to ensure efficient and safe removal.
Are there different methods for concrete floor removal? Yes, contractors may use methods such as jackhammering, grinding, or saw-cutting, depending on the scope and location of the project.
What should I consider before hiring a contractor for concrete floor demolition? It's important to evaluate their experience, equipment, and ability to handle the specific type of demolition needed for your project.
Can local service providers handle demolition in confined or indoor spaces? Many local contractors are equipped to perform concrete floor demolition in various settings, including indoor areas with limited space.
What safety precautions are taken during concrete floor demolition? Contractors typically follow safety protocols such as wearing protective gear and controlling dust and debris to ensure a safe work environment.
